What is the California Housing Crisis Act of 2019 Form?
The California Housing Crisis Act of 2019 Form plays a crucial role in determining if a residential dwelling unit is classified as a 'Protected Unit' under the Act. Defined by the Housing Crisis Act of 2019 (SB 330), this form requires tenants to provide essential information that helps identify units eligible for protection against displacement in light of new housing developments. Completing this form is vital for tenants residing in properties affected by this Act, as it reinforces their rights and housing stability.

Who is eligible to complete the California Housing Crisis Act of 2019 Form?
Any tenant residing in a property that may be affected by new housing developments in California is eligible to complete this form. It specifically pertains to those who need to verify their income for potential housing replacement determination.
What is the deadline for submitting the completed form?
Completed forms must be submitted to the Los Angeles Housing and Community Investment Department within two weeks of receiving the associated letter. Timely submission is critical to ensure your unit's protection status is considered.
How do I submit the California Housing Crisis Act of 2019 Form?
The form should be submitted directly to the Los Angeles Housing and Community Investment Department, either by mail or in person. Make sure to keep a copy for your records.
What supporting documents do I need to provide with the form?
You need to include income verification documents, such as pay stubs, bank statements, or tax returns, unless you opt to decline providing such financial information.
